  • 💥 Social Media Changed Everything. Are You Still in Denial?
    This is the full keynote and Q&A from my 2022 talk at the NAHREP conference in San Diego — and honestly, it hits harder now than it did back then.

    I break down exactly why content is still the most practical way to grow your business, why so many people are still making excuses instead of doing the work, and how the real estate industry — and every industry — is being reshaped by social media, blockchain, and attention shifts.

    This isn’t a motivational speech — it’s a wake-up call. The world already changed. TikTok isn’t just for kids. LinkedIn isn’t just for job hunters. Facebook Groups are still gold. If you’re not creating content that builds trust, educates your audience, or puts you top of mind — you’re falling behind, fast.

    We talk about:

    • Why content on social is still the #1 way to win

    • What blockchain and smart contracts mean for real estate

    • How to lead your team with empathy — not fear

    • The difference between kindness and manipulation

    • Why your ego is killing your wallet

    • And why “doing the homework” matters more now than ever
